Effect of Glytan on the Expression of the Nicotinic Acetylcholine Receptor a7 in Portal Hypertensive Rats
This study aimed to observe the expression of the nicotinic acetylcholine receptor nAchRa7 in liver tissue after portal hypertension (PHT). In the study, 40 male Sprague-Dawley rats, with weights between 240 g and 260 g, were randomly divided into sham-operated group, model group, and Glytan group according to their weights. Each group was observed at two time points, namely, two and four weeks after PHT. Common bile duct ligation was carried out on rats to induce PHT. The portal pressure of each group was measured, and the expression of nAchR a7 in the liver was detected by Western blotting at each time point. Results showed that the portal pressure and the expression of nAchRa7 in the model group increased significantly at two and four weeks after PHT. The portal pressure of the Glytan group was decreased compared to the model group, especially at four weeks after PHT. The expression of nAchRa7 in the liver of the Glytan group decreased significantly at four weeks after PHT. It is concluded that the change of portal pressure and the expression of nAchRa7 in the model and Glytan groups is consistent with the time sequence. Glytan may downregulate the portal pressure by affecting the nAchRa7 level in the liver.
